Dr. Guralnik emphasizes that couples must shift focus from self-centered perspectives to learning about their partners, fostering better communication and understanding.
She argues that contemporary relationships suffer from a solipsistic approach, where individuals prioritize their need for validation over truly listening to their partners.
In her view, successful relationships depend on asking, 'What can I learn about my partner?' rather than solely striving to express one's own perspective.
Guralnik suggests that letting go of the need for constant validation allows couples to engage more deeply, enhancing their connection and emotional intimacy.
